Transaction 4e28e8f9093c03685d076961716271d1097afcf202a0981f32d1142674f368ed

2 Input
2 Outputs
  • 4e28e8f9093c03685d076961716271d1097afcf202a0981f32d1142674f368ed:0
  • value  499000
    address  34hmzyQxz9s8J8YfqgSXWG61DHBgrDR1KY
  • 4e28e8f9093c03685d076961716271d1097afcf202a0981f32d1142674f368ed:1
  • value  35590
    address  19NwPjoX331DBVAEuZG64oXgyVaV6EoPoD